Sietze de Vries is a Dutch organist and known for his ingenious improvisations. Joachim Scheufele-Leidig transcribed some of his improvisations and made those nice editions available. This piece on the Christmas hymn 'Vom Himmel hoch, da komm ich her' was one of the variations Sietze improvised on the organ of the Sankt-Martini-Kirche, Bremen (find the link in this description for all the variations en beautiful singing of the hymn verses between the variations). It's a pastorale-like piece with the cantus firmus in the pedal part, which makes it a piece with double pedal.
